#b86a36 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b86a36 is composed of 72.2% red, 41.6% green and 21.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.4% magenta, 70.7%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 24 degrees, a saturation of 54.6% and a lightness of 46.7%. #b86a36 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d46c with #710000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

Shades and Tints of #b86a36

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020101 is the darkest color, while #fbf6f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b86a36

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#787776 is the less saturated color, while #e66108 is the most saturated one.
